A race report tells you what happened. A dashboard shows you why. Lap times, tire stints, pit stops, position changes, and the effect of every safety-car phase — the metrics race engineers use to read a 24-hour race, all in one place and ready to explore for yourself.

We’re starting with Le Mans — the strongest endurance race on the international calendar. Nürburgring, Daytona, and a WEC season dashboard will follow. Every dashboard is built from the same data as the Race Intelligence analyses; nothing is invented by hand, everything is reproducible.
